Output c336461f740029d830662afbe0787ef860731a74e18d90091abf7a2897bf72ef:5

value
267363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dac01c28df1854f2a52b1128af37af9fcefc366 OP_EQUAL
address
38mi1ZYS6y3ynPSr66Ne7KuxcYT21crX24
transaction
c336461f740029d830662afbe0787ef860731a74e18d90091abf7a2897bf72ef
confirmations
324339
spent
true